What affects the price

When you start looking at cruise prices, keep in mind that the total depends on a few moving parts. The cabin category is the biggest factor; choosing a suite or a balcony room will always cost more than an interior stateroom. Timing is just as important, as sailing during school holidays or peak vacation weeks usually increases the fare. Plus, you have to consider whether you want an all-inclusive package that covers drinks and Wi-Fi, or if you prefer to pay for those as you go. This term is often used as slang for a cruise ship that has experienced a major mechanical or sanitation failure while at sea, resulting in unpleasant conditions for passengers. People usually search for this when they are worried about the reliability of older ships or reading sensationalized news reports.
